Base64 to XML Converter






A Base64 to XML Converter is a digital tool that specializes in transforming Base64 encoded strings back into their original XML document format. This powerful utility bridges the complex gap between encoded data representation and structured XML content. The converter takes Base64 encoded input, which appears as a seemingly random string of alphanumeric characters, and methodically decodes it to reconstruct the original XML structure with remarkable precision.

The process involves intricate character mapping, where each Base64 character is systematically converted back to its original binary representation. This transformation ensures that every XML tag, attribute, and nested element is accurately restored, maintaining the complete informational integrity of the original document throughout the conversion process.

How does a Base64 to XML Converter Works?

1. Input Reception
The converter receives a Base64 encoded string, which is a compact representation of binary data using 64 different alphanumeric characters and two additional symbols (+/). This input is carefully captured and prepared for the decoding process.

2. Preliminary Validation
The tool first validates the Base64 encoded string, checking for proper formatting, character composition, and ensuring no unauthorized characters are present in the input.

3. Decoding Mechanism
Using a systematic character-to-binary mapping, the converter transforms the Base64 string back into its original binary representation. Each Base64 character is mapped to a 6-bit binary sequence, reconstructing the original byte-level data.

4. Binary to Text Conversion
Once the binary data is restored, the converter interprets the bytes, translating them back into the original text characters that compose the XML document.

5. XML Structure Reconstruction
The tool carefully rebuilds the XML structure, reestablishing tags, attributes, and nested elements to match the original document's precise formatting and hierarchy.

6. Output Generation
The final step produces a fully reconstructed XML document, delivering a perfect replica of the original XML content before it was Base64 encoded.

Benefits of Base64 to XML Converter Tool

1. Data Integrity Restoration

The Base64 to XML Converter ensures complete and accurate reconstruction of original XML documents. By precisely mapping encoded characters back to their original structure, the tool guarantees that every tag, attribute, and nested element is perfectly restored, maintaining the document's comprehensive informational content without any data loss.

2. Cross-Platform Interoperability

This converter provides seamless data translation across different technological ecosystems. Organizations can effortlessly transfer XML documents encoded in Base64 between varying computing environments, programming languages, and network infrastructures without compromising the original document's structural integrity.

3. Enhanced Data Security

By supporting the decoding of Base64 encoded XML, the tool enables secure data transmission and storage methods. Base64 encoding acts as an initial layer of data obfuscation, and the converter allows authorized users to safely reconstruct sensitive XML documents while maintaining their original formatting and content.

4. Efficient Data Recovery

The converter eliminates manual reconstruction challenges, offering automated and instantaneous transformation of encoded strings back to readable XML format. This efficiency significantly reduces time and computational resources required for data recovery and interpretation.

5. Universal Compatibility

Supporting multiple encoding standards and XML schemas, the converter provides a flexible solution for diverse technological requirements. It can handle complex XML structures from various domains, including financial, healthcare, enterprise, and web service environments.

6. Debugging and Validation

The tool serves as an essential diagnostic instrument for developers and system administrators. It allows comprehensive examination of encoded XML documents, facilitating troubleshooting, verification of data transmission integrity, and ensuring accurate representation of complex information structures.

Real-World Use Cases of Base64 to XML Converter Tool

1. Healthcare Information Management

Hospitals and medical institutions use this converter to decode encrypted patient records transmitted between healthcare systems. When medical records are encoded for secure transmission, the Base64 to XML converter allows healthcare professionals to quickly restore complex patient information, treatment histories, and diagnostic reports to their original structured XML format.

2. Financial Transaction Processing

Banking systems rely on this tool to decode Base64 encoded XML documents containing critical financial transaction details. When transferring sensitive financial information between different banking platforms, the converter ensures that transaction records, account statements, and payment instructions are accurately reconstructed without losing any critical metadata.

3. Cloud Service Configuration

Cloud service providers utilize the converter to decode configuration files and service descriptions stored in Base64 format. This enables seamless migration of complex system configurations across different cloud environments, ensuring that intricate XML-based infrastructure settings are perfectly restored.

4. Internet of Things (IoT) Data Integration

IoT devices frequently encode sensor data and device configurations using Base64. The converter allows central monitoring systems to decode these transmissions, reconstructing XML documents that contain critical information about device status, sensor readings, and system diagnostics.

5. Software Update Mechanisms

Software development teams use this tool to decode update packages and configuration files encoded in Base64. When distributing software updates across multiple platforms, the converter ensures that XML-based installation instructions and system configurations are accurately restored.

6. Enterprise Communication Systems

Large corporations employ the Base64 to XML converter to decode complex communication protocols and data exchange formats. This is particularly crucial in scenarios involving inter-departmental data sharing, where XML documents contain structured information about business processes, inventory management, and corporate communications.